Window Well Waterproofing in Denver, CO
Window well waterproofing services help protect basement windows and underground spaces from water intrusion and moisture damage. This service typically involves sealing and waterproofing window wells, installing drainage systems, and applying protective coatings to prevent water from seeping into the foundation. Projects often include upgrading existing window wells, installing new wells for basement egress windows, or repairing damaged or deteriorated waterproofing to ensure the basement remains dry and free from water-related issues.

Common Window Well Waterproofing Jobs
Window well waterproofing helps prevent water from seeping into basements through window openings.
Drainage system installation directs water away from window wells to protect foundation integrity.
Sealant application creates a watertight barrier around window well edges for added protection.
Crack and damage repair addresses existing issues that could allow water intrusion.
Gutter and downspout extensions work to divert rainwater away from window wells and foundation.
Waterproof membrane installation provides a durable layer to keep basements dry during heavy rain.
Window Well Waterproofing Questions
What is window well waterproofing? It involves sealing and protecting window wells to prevent water from leaking into basements or lower levels during heavy rain or snowmelt.
Why is waterproofing window wells important? Proper waterproofing helps avoid water damage, mold growth, and structural issues caused by water infiltration around basement windows.
What types of projects typically require window well waterproofing? Projects include new basement window installations, existing window wells showing signs of water leakage, or areas prone to heavy rain and snow runoff.
How does waterproofing improve basement safety? Waterproofing reduces the risk of water pooling and potential flooding, helping maintain a dry, safe basement environment.
